NH White Mountain Winter Camping

This time I haul my backpack up to Moat Mountain, in the area of North Conway, New Hampshire. There was recent snowfall here so I wear snowshoes up the 3 mile trail, gaining 2000 feet in elevation.

    I think this video is one of your best. The night sky with stars is awesome!! What camera did you use and what settings. Thanks Tina

  • @RachelWhelton

    @RachelWhelton

    10 күн бұрын

    Wow, thanks. Camera on those night shots is a Sony A7iv with a 20mm lens set fully open to 1.8 aperture. I stand there trying different durations between 10 and 20 seconds. My editing is minimal without any "stacking" or professional editing techniques. Usually it's a bit of luck for me on what I get from the sky at night. Most helpful factor is the 1.8 aperture lens but a lot of different cameras could do the job.
